Final sounds in Grade 1 phonics instruction represent a critical milestone in early literacy development, as students learn to identify and distinguish the concluding phonemes in spoken and written words. Wayground's extensive collection of final sounds quizzes provides systematic assessment opportunities that help young learners master this essential decoding skill through targeted practice questions and immediate feedback. These interactive resources develop phonemic awareness by challenging students to recognize ending consonant sounds, vowel patterns, and common word endings, building the foundation necessary for successful reading and spelling advancement. The quizzes offer structured practice that reinforces understanding of how final sounds contribute to word recognition and pronunciation accuracy.
